  • Stainless steel fiber blended antistatic and EMI shielding conductive yarn

    Stainless steel fiber blended antistatic and EMI shielding conductive yarn

    Stainless steel fiber blended yarn is a range of single or multi-ply spun yarns. The yarns are a blend of stainless steel fibers with cotton、ployester or aramid fibers.
    This mix results in an efficient, conductive medium with antistatic and EMI shielding properties. Featuring thin diameters, stainless steel fiber blended yarns are very
    flexible and light,guarantees the safety and quality of your products. The spun
    yarns processed into a correct fabric configuration meet the international
    EN 1149-51 , EN 61340, ISO 6356 and DIN 54345-5 standards as well the
    OEKO-TEX® and REACH regulations that restrict harmful substances.

  • Silver Metallized Tinsel Wire

    Silver Metallized Tinsel Wire

    It’s silver plated copper high strength wire made by flattened silver-plated copper wire in wrapped textile filaments,due to the intermediate textile wire supporting so the conductor wire is more flexible and durable. Wrapped textile filaments can be polyamide, aramid or other textile filaments according to your specify.

  • Tinned Metallized Tinsel Wire

    Tinned Metallized Tinsel Wire

    It’s copper plated tin high strength wire made by flattened copper-plated tin wire in wrapped textile filaments. Tin forms oxide films to prevent copper oxidation soon,intermediate textile wire supported wire strength and bending performance so the conductor wire is more flexible and durable,inner Wrapped textile filaments can be polyamide, aramid or other textile filaments according to your special specify.

  • Stainless steel fiber spun yarn

    Stainless steel fiber spun yarn

    Stainless steel fiber spun yarn be made of stainless steel metal wires drawing  into fibers and then spun to yarns, due to its stainless steel metal properties so stainless steel spun yarn has high temperature resistance and conductive properties which be mainly used for conductive and high temperature resistant tapes, tubing, and fabric producing, textile characters of stainless steel spun yarn can be braiding,knitting and weaving.
